PowerBook memory test shows faster using PC5300

Not so much a question but an observation.

I have two sets of memory that I have been using with my PowerBook G4 9969. The 2GB of PC4200 that came with it and 2GB of PC5300 from a Dell D630. When the PC5300 is installed system profiler shows them as PC2-3200S-288 but running Rember tests complete in 7 seconds vs 9 when using the stock PC4200. Xbench also gives a slightly higher score with the PC5300.
